Foundation repair services address issues related to the stability and integrity of a property’s foundation. These projects typically involve diagnosing problems such as cracks, settling, or shifting that can cause uneven floors, doors or windows that don’t close properly, and other structural concerns. Property owners often seek foundation repair after noticing signs of damage or experiencing changes in the building’s appearance or functionality, aiming to prevent further deterioration and protect the value of their home.
Before requesting foundation repair, homeowners usually want to understand the scope of the work needed, the types of repair methods available, and the potential causes of foundation issues. Common approaches include underpinning, piering, or stabilization techniques designed to restore support and prevent future problems. Clear communication about the extent of damage and the recommended solutions can help property owners make informed decisions about maintaining the safety and stability of their property.

Common Foundation Repair Jobs
Foundation Crack Repair - addresses visible cracks to prevent further structural damage.
Slab Stabilization - lifts and levels uneven concrete slabs to improve safety and appearance.
Pier and Beam Repair - reinforces or replaces supports to ensure foundation stability.
Basement Wall Reinforcement - strengthens basement walls to prevent bowing or collapse.
Waterproofing Foundations - applies moisture barriers to protect against water intrusion and damage.
Soil Stabilization - improves soil conditions around the foundation to reduce shifting and settling.
Foundation Repair Questions
What are common signs of foundation problems? Visible cracks in walls or floors, uneven flooring, and doors or windows that stick may indicate foundation issues.
How does foundation repair benefit property owners? Repairing the foundation helps stabilize the structure, prevents further damage, and maintains property value.
What types of foundation repair are available? Methods include underpinning, piering, and stabilization to address different types of foundation movement or damage.
When is foundation repair necessary? Repair is needed when signs of settling, cracking, or shifting are observed that affect the stability of the property.
